Top St Louis Shaved Dessert Shop | Reviews & Ratings | comparemela.com
St louis shaved dessert shop in United states - 63129/ near st-louis
St louis shaved dessert shop in United states - 63031/ near st-louis
St louis shaved dessert shop in United states - 63074/ near st-louis